A federal judge on Friday temporarily halted deportations of eight immigrants to war-torn South Sudan the day after the Supreme Court greenlighted their removal, saying new claims by the immigrants’ lawyers deserved a hearing.
District Judge Randolph Moss proceeded with the extraordinary Fourth of July hearing on Friday afternoon, directing the Trump administration to discuss whether a prior Supreme Court ruling that immigrants slated for removal under an 18th century wartime act invoked by President Donald Trump deserve due process might also apply to those due to be removed to South Sudan.
The administration has been trying to deport the immigrants for weeks. None are from South Sudan, which is enmeshed in civil war and where the U.S government advises no one should travel before making their own funeral arrangements. The government flew them to Djibouti but couldn’t move them further because a Massachusetts court had ruled no immigrant could be sent to a new country without a chance to have a court hearing.
The Supreme Court vacated that decision last month, then Thursday night issued a new order clarifying that that meant the immigrants could be moved to South Sudan. Lawyers for the immigrants, who hail from Laos, Mexico, Myanmar, Vietnam and other countries, filed an emergency request to halt their removal later that night.

Update: Emergency proceedings are underway related to the potential deportation of 8 men to South Sudan before Judge Randy Moss in Washington.
The men are teed up to be transferred at 7pm tonight. But Moss is sending the case to MA, where he says it should be handled.
Moss granted a 1 hour stay to give lawyers for the men a chance to file their emergency claim in Massachusetts.
Lawyer for Trump administration says they will appeal to the Supreme Court immediatelty.
MOSS has grave concerns about facilitating the deportation of people to potentially life threatening circumstances in South Sudan, but he thinks his hands are tied by the Supreme Court’s stay yesterday.
Still, he says the SCOTUS rulings were devoid of reasoning so it’s not totally clear.
Moss essentially said he couldn’t help but would send case to MA. The lawyers for the men aren’t sure tehy can raise a judge on July 4th in time to even ask for relief ahead of 7pm deportation.
